Property-specific tips for evaluating Burton Street and the surrounding area
Even if 22361 BURTON ST LOS ANGELES CA 91304 is not available today, the address is still useful as a planning anchor. Start by confirming the property type and zoning, because that affects loan eligibility and future flexibility. In many Los Angeles neighborhoods, buyers also watch for ADU potential. If an ADU is possible, it can change appraisal expectations and rental strategy. Next, review the lot characteristics and any slope or drainage concerns. Those can influence insurance costs and inspection priorities. Ask your agent for recent comparable sales within a tight radius. In shifting markets, older comps can mislead your offer price. Also check days on market trends, because they signal negotiation power. If inventory is rising, you may negotiate credits for repairs or rate buydowns. If inventory is tight, you may need a stronger down payment story. For financing, plan for property taxes, hazard insurance, and possible supplemental tax bills after closing. California supplemental assessments can surprise buyers. We help you estimate those costs early, so your budget stays realistic. Finally, align your offer timeline with your loan timeline.
